Kann eine physische Speicherseite in mehreren virtuellen Adressräumen verwendet werden?
Adressraum). Nur Betriebssysteme, die eine virtuelle Speicherverwaltung verwenden, können einen virtuellen Adressraum generieren und dadurch Speicherseiten, die physisch nicht zusammenhängend sind, für den Programmierer bzw. das Programm als logisch zusammenhängenden Speicherbereich abbilden.
Was ist der virtuelle Speicher?
Der virtuelle Speicher bezeichnet den vom tatsächlich vorhandenen Arbeitsspeicher unabhängigen Adressraum, der einem Prozess vom Betriebssystem zur Verfügung gestellt wird. Das Konzept entstand in den 1950er Jahren und wird heute von den meisten Prozessorarchitekturen unterstützt und in nahezu allen modernen Betriebssystemen verwendet.
Wie groß ist der virtuelle Arbeitsspeicher?
Unten finden Sie den Punkt “ Virtueller Arbeitsspeicher „. Sie können direkt sehen, wie groß Ihre Auslagerungsdatei ist. In diesem Beispiel ist die Größe 10011 MB, also etwa 10 GB. Klicken Sie auf “ Ändern… „, um die Einstellungen für den virtuellen Arbeitsspeicher anzupassen. 6. Schritt:
Wie wird ein virtueller Arbeitsspeicher unterteilt?
In einem System mit virtuellem Arbeitsspeicher wird der physische Speicher in mehrere gleichgroße Seiten, sogenannte Pages unterteilt. Der von einem Prozess adressierte Arbeitsspeicher wird ebenfalls in logische Seiten derselben Größe unterteilt. Wenn ein Prozess auf eine bestimmte Adresse im virtuellen…
Was ist das Konzept der virtuellen Speicherverwaltung?
Das Konzept der virtuellen Speicherverwaltung entstand aus der Trennung in primäre Speichermedien, auf die der Prozessor direkt Zugriff hatte (meist Magnetkernspeicher ), und sekundäre externe Speichermedien (meist Magnettrommelspeicher) in den Computern der 1950er Jahre und dem Wunsch, diese automatisch auf gleicher Ebene zu verwalten.